Congratulations! I went to Ithaca College, which is on the other hill from CU. Ithaca is an interesting town... that's for sure. College Town is a fun lil area... and so is the Commons... for a small town, it's not bad.
Here's some tips... Little Joe's and Big Joe's... YUM. Great restaurants. Little Joe's over in College Town is pretty good... but Big Joe's has a better menu... and a longer wait...
Nite time snack? DP DOUGH. The worlds best calzones. They had over 40 different kinds of 'zones last I knew... the Falling Rock Zone was my favorite... it was potatoes, bacon, and a bunch of cheeses... with sour cream to dip in... soo good.
Pizza? Gotta go with Rogan's... it's on the South Hill near IC... best pizza and wings in town, hands down.
Night time partying? Im sure it's all changed... but The Haunt was always fun... if it's still there, it's downtown, next to DP Dough. Of course, I always went to the Common Ground... but... that might not be your cup of tea.
Late night breakfast, we always used to go to the State Street Diner... the place was built in the 50's... and hadn't been updated since. Dirty, lousy and rude service, cold grease dripping food... we loved it... LOL
